  • Abstract
    Reliable operation of power system is fundamental to the on-going industry reform. This paper presents the result of marginal power flow evaluation performed on Korean power system for planning mode. It uses two commercial software packages: physical and operational margins (POM V. 2.2) and probabilistic reliability assessment (PRA V. 3.1), respectively. The case studies of Korea power system for year 2007 - 2012 data show that these packages are effective in identifying possible weak points and root causes for likely reliability problems for long term planning. The potential for these software packages is being explored further for assisting system operators and planners with managing and planning Korea power system under real-life setting in the near future.
